Transaction 246542bf52aebe5242d5bd3e629f107b1133c951fecf8193d213f50db5a104f8
1 Input
1 Output
-
246542bf52aebe5242d5bd3e629f107b1133c951fecf8193d213f50db5a104f8:0
- value
- 1094884
- script pubkey
- OP_0 OP_PUSHBYTES_32 b9738fd5e5f652d82aa1d917339b619c26b1b8fd6b9fc4f57661d80838217e0d
- address
- bc1qh9ecl4097efds24pmytn8xmpnsntrw8adw0ufatkv8vqswpp0cxsfd7gr5